  12/* The MPS2 and MPS2+ dev boards are FPGA based (the 2+ has a bigger
  13 * FPGA but is otherwise the same as the 2). Since the CPU itself
  14 * and most of the devices are in the FPGA, the details of the board
  15 * as seen by the guest depend significantly on the FPGA image.
  16 * We model the following FPGA images:
  17 *  "mps2-an385" -- Cortex-M3 as documented in ARM Application Note AN385
  18 *  "mps2-an511" -- Cortex-M3 'DesignStart' as documented in AN511
  19 *
  20 * Links to the TRM for the board itself and to the various Application
  21 * Notes which document the FPGA images can be found here:
  22 *   https://developer.arm.com/products/system-design/development-boards/cortex-m-prototyping-system
  23 */

 121    /* The FPGA images have an odd combination of different RAMs,
 122     * because in hardware they are different implementations and
 123     * connected to different buses, giving varying performance/size
 124     * tradeoffs. For QEMU they're all just RAM, though. We arbitrarily
 125     * call the 16MB our "system memory", as it's the largest lump.
 126     *
 127     * Common to both boards:
 128     *  0x21000000..0x21ffffff : PSRAM (16MB)
 129     * AN385 only:
 130     *  0x00000000 .. 0x003fffff : ZBT SSRAM1
 131     *  0x00400000 .. 0x007fffff : mirror of ZBT SSRAM1
 132     *  0x20000000 .. 0x203fffff : ZBT SSRAM 2&3
 133     *  0x20400000 .. 0x207fffff : mirror of ZBT SSRAM 2&3
 134     *  0x01000000 .. 0x01003fff : block RAM (16K)
 135     *  0x01004000 .. 0x01007fff : mirror of above
 136     *  0x01008000 .. 0x0100bfff : mirror of above
 137     *  0x0100c000 .. 0x0100ffff : mirror of above
 138     * AN511 only:
 139     *  0x00000000 .. 0x0003ffff : FPGA block RAM
 140     *  0x00400000 .. 0x007fffff : ZBT SSRAM1
 141     *  0x20000000 .. 0x2001ffff : SRAM
 142     *  0x20400000 .. 0x207fffff : ZBT SSRAM 2&3
 143     *
 144     * The AN385 has a feature where the lowest 16K can be mapped
 145     * either to the bottom of the ZBT SSRAM1 or to the block RAM.
 146     * This is of no use for QEMU so we don't implement it (as if
 147     * zbt_boot_ctrl is always zero).
 148     */
